The Multifaceted Brahms with contralto Emily Marvosh

SEE EVENT DETAILS
at Schroeder Hall at Green Music Center (see times)
Valley of the Moon Music Festival's 2017 Green Music Center concert series concludes with a program devoted to Brahms. Boston-based contralto Emily Marvosh will take the stage alongside a cohort of distinguished musicians including violinists Jodi Levitz, Bettina Mussumeli and Ian Swensen, cellist Tanya Tomkins, Sadie Glass on the natural horn, and Eric Zivian on fortepiano.

Marvosh has been a frequent soloist with the Handel and Haydn Society under the direction of Harry Christophers, earning raves for her "rich, clear contralto" (Washington Post), "dark, caramel voice...and fiery power" (Boston Classical Review).
